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Incan Broad-nosed Bat | Mashpi Stream Treefrog |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Phyllostomidae | Hylidae |
| Genus | Platyrrhinus | Hyloscirtus |
| Species | Platyrrhinus incarum | Hyloscirtus mashpi |
Evolutionary Relationship
Incan Broad-nosed Bat and Mashpi Stream Treefrog share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
